33 #ifndef CXXBLAS_LEVEL2_SPR2_TCC
34 #define CXXBLAS_LEVEL2_SPR2_TCC 1
35
36 #include <complex>
37 #include <cxxblas/level1/level1.h>
38
39 namespace cxxblas {
40
41 template <typename IndexType, typename ALPHA, typename VX, typename VY,
42 typename MA>
43 void
44 spr2_generic(StorageOrder order, StorageUpLo upLo,
45 IndexType n,
46 const ALPHA &alpha,
47 const VX *x, IndexType incX,
48 const VY *y, IndexType incY,
49 MA *A)
50 {
51 if (order==ColMajor) {
52 upLo = (upLo==Upper) ? Lower : Upper;
53 spr2_generic(RowMajor, upLo, n, alpha, x, incX, y, incY, A);
54 return;
55 }
56 #ifdef CXXBLAS_USE_XERBLA
57 // insert error check here
58 #endif
59 if (upLo==Upper) {
60 for (IndexType i=0, iX=0, iY=0; i<n; ++i, iX+=incX, iY+=incY) {
61 axpy_generic(n-i, alpha*x[iX], y+iY, incY,
62 A+i*(2*n-i+1)/2, IndexType(1));
63 axpy_generic(n-i, alpha*y[iY], x+iX, incX,
64 A+i*(2*n-i+1)/2, IndexType(1));
65 }
66 } else {
67 for (IndexType i=0, iX=0, iY=0; i<n; ++i, iX+=incX, iY+=incY) {
68 axpy_generic(i+1, alpha*x[iX], y, incY,
69 A+i*(i+1)/2, IndexType(1));
70 axpy_generic(i+1, alpha*y[iY], x, incX,
71 A+i*(i+1)/2, IndexType(1));
72 }
73 }
74 }
75
76 template <typename IndexType, typename ALPHA, typename VX, typename VY,
77 typename MA>
78 void
79 spr2(StorageOrder order, StorageUpLo upLo,
80 IndexType n,
81 const ALPHA &alpha,
82 const VX *x, IndexType incX,
83 const VY *y, IndexType incY,
84 MA *A)
85 {
86 CXXBLAS_DEBUG_OUT("spr2_generic");
87
88 if (incX<0) {
89 x -= incX*(n-1);
90 }
91 if (incY<0) {
92 y -= incY*(n-1);
93 }
94 spr2_generic(order, upLo, n, alpha, x, incX, y, incY, A);
95 }
96
97 } // namespace cxxblas
98
99 #endif // CXXBLAS_LEVEL2_SPR2_TCC
